Game Description
Namco and Eutechnyx's Street Racing Syndicate is the first game to seriously combine the life-sim aspects of Grand Theft Auto and The Sims with virtual car racing. Based on the high life of street racing bad boys, SRC takes us into a wild world where racers customize cars with illegal parts and bet their female groupies. It's tasteless but fun, because throughout the game you will have to balance a girlfriend, your reputation, your racing career and your beloved car! At every turn on and off the streets you will have to make big decisions, whether to escape the cops, upset your groupies or go for the ultimate street cred.
